What Caused the Extinction of Dinosaurs?

The reason for the complete extinction of dinosaurs has long been a subject of debate in the field of Paleontology. However, just recently, an international panel composed of experts across the globe has endorsed and supported the old theory that the extinction of dinosaurs is linked to a huge heavenly bodies such as an asteroid or comet that smashed on the earth's atmosphere releasing an energy that is as strong as

"...100 trillion tonnes of TNT - over a billion times more explosive than the bombs dropped on Hiroshima and Nagasaki."

as evidenced on the 10km-15km space rock that was believed to have struck Yucatan, Mexico"(Chicxulub crater).

The scientists believe that the comet/asteroid struck the earth with speed that is almost 20 times as fast as (or possibly more), a speeding bullet. The impact could have created earthquakes, tsunamis which later inundated regions occupied by dinosaurs and killed dinosaur species dominating the air such as the pterosaurs, an event which lead the way for the domination of mammals on earth.
